This information is required to register your son for the Entrance Examination for Year 7 entry in September 2025. All applicants must have a date of birth ranging between 1st September 2013 and 31st August 2014. The Entrance Examination will take place on Friday 20th September 2024. The closing date for applications is midday on Friday 12th July 2024.
A copy of the Saint Ambrose College Admissions Policy 2025 can be found on the College website at: Admissions Policy 2025. The Policy outlines the College's oversubscription criteria should more applicants achieve the qualifying score than there are places available.

Pupil Premium is additional funding paid annually to schools under Section 14 of the Education Act 2002 for the purposes of supporting the attainment of disadvantaged children. The Service Premium is additional funding paid annually to schools under section 14 of the Education Act 2002 for the purposes of supporting the pastoral needs of the children of Armed Services Personnel.
